Here's the magic behind the flywheel effect:



The chain pulls in revenue. That cash gets funneled straight into DeFi yields—pumping returns higher. Higher yields attract more activity, which means even more revenue flowing back in. Then? Rinse and repeat.

It's a self-reinforcing loop that doesn't take breaks. The engine keeps running, the yields keep climbing, and the cycle feeds itself relentlessly.
